WebGreece is enhancing its facilities for importing LNG and securing the energy supply. The LNG terminal on Revithoussa Island, the country’s only operative LNG terminal, is part of the NNGTS and thus owned and operated by DESFA, as provided for under Article 67, para. 1 of the Energy Law. WebMar 29, 2024 · The 2.6 Bcm/year capacity floating LNG import terminal began operations in January 2024 and is the first LNG import facility to serve the Balkan region directly. It has received a total of 25 cargoes since it started, representing a volume of 2.2 Bcm of gas equivalent, according to data from S&P Global Commodity Insights.
